Earplugs work by dampening out unwanted sounds, creating a sense of tranquility. They come in a variety of types, from soft foam to custom-molded options, to suit your preferences. Whether you're struggling with noise from traffic, neighbors, or even your own partner, earplugs can offer a welcome respite.
